Bethel Acres, OK vs Whitehorn Cove, OK
Bethel Acres, OK and Whitehorn Cove, OK have a very similar cost of living, with only a 4.7% difference in their overall index. Bethel Acres scores 75 while Whitehorn Cove scores 72 on the cost of living index, where 100 represents the national average. The day-to-day expenses for residents in both cities are comparable, though differences emerge when looking at specific categories.
On the housing front, median rent in Bethel Acres is $935/month compared to $746/month in Whitehorn Cove — a 25%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while Whitehorn Cove has cheaper rent, Bethel Acres actually has lower median home values ($177,700 vs $213,500).
Median household income in Bethel Acres is $82,500 compared to $62,426 in Whitehorn Cove (+32.2%). While Bethel Acres is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Bethel Acres spend roughly 13.6% of their income on rent, less than the 14.3% in Whitehorn Cove.
